💰 What Does Pet Relocation Cost in Meridian?

Pricing for pet relocation in Meridian varies widely based on factors like distance, complexity, and the services required. Typically, domestic relocations in Meridian range from $300-$1,500+, while international moves can start at $1,500 and go up to $5,000+ depending on destinations and permits. Concierge relocation packages, offering end-to-end solutions, generally cost between $2,000-$6,000+. Additional services such as veterinary coordination, crate preparation, and documentation can range from $100-$500. Credentials & What to Look For

Selecting the right pet relocation provider in Meridian involves checking for several key credentials. Ensure that your chosen specialists are USDA APHIS registered, which is necessary for handling interstate or international moves. Verify that they hold the appropriate state and local business licenses, alongside professional pet handling certifications and liability insurance. It's also crucial to ascertain their experience with international documentation and customs processes if you're planning an overseas move. Vet Documentation & Travel Requirements

For domestic relocations, a Certificate of Veterinary Inspection (CVI) issued by a licensed veterinarian within 10 days of travel is standard procedure. In Idaho, up-to-date vaccination records, including rabies, are mandatory for all interstate moves. Hence, advance vet coordination is advised to avoid last-minute certificate delays.

International relocations demand more detailed preparation, including destination-country import permits, ISO-compliant microchipping, and potentially quarantine arrangements or specific health tests. It's essential to start this process weeks in advance, given the complexity of requirements. Weather and Pet Safety in Meridian

Meridian experiences a mild climate with distinct seasons. Summers can reach average highs of about 89°F, while winter temperatures can drop to around 24°F. Although not extreme, it's vital to ensure that transport arrangements include climate-controlled vehicles, especially for temperature-sensitive breeds. Pet parents should plan moves during moderate weather conditions when possible and confirm that their relocation specialist has protocols for safe transport in varying temperatures.
